Initial installation costs for solar panels can range from $15,000 to $50,000 depending on the system size and location. Farmers can access funding through government grants, such as the USDA's Rural Energy for America Program (REAP).
The best times to clean solar panels are early morning or evening to avoid hot sun that can cause streaking. You'll need a few basic tools like a soft brush, a squeegee, and a hose to clean your panels effectively.
